> >>Sound is working fine for all applications in Ubuntu, and I have the
> >>Macromedia Flash files (flashplayer.xpt and libflashplayer.so  in my
> >>.mozilla/plugins  folder, but I'm not getting any sound when a webpage
> >>with a flash-based video plays.  Any ideas?   I've checked all my volume
> >>settings and everything is up.   This has happened to 2 different
> >>computers so far.

> Thanks John, the command ln -s /usr/lib/libesd.so.0 /usr/lib/libesd.so.1
>  in a terminal window did the trick.
